Main Ingredients
Right, let's get down to brass tacks. You'll need:
- 2 lbs (900g) beef chuck, cut into 1 inch cubes. Look for marbling that's where the flavour is, mate!
- 2 tablespoons (30ml) all-purpose flour, seasoned with salt and pepper.
- 2 tablespoons (30ml) vegetable oil.
- 1 large onion, chopped (about 1 cup ).
- 2 carrots, peeled and chopped (about 1 cup ).
- 2 celery stalks, chopped (about 1 cup ).
- 2 cloves garlic, minced.
- 1 lb (450g) Yukon gold potatoes, peeled and cubed (about 3 medium ones). I swear by Yukon Golds; they get lovely and creamy.
- 1 cup (125g) frozen peas. Chuck 'em in at the end.
- 1 cup (125g) frozen green beans (optional). My nan always added them; it's a nostalgia thing for me.
- 4 cups (950ml) beef broth. Go for low sodium if you’re watching the salt.
- 1 cup (240ml) dry red wine (optional). A decent Cabernet Sauvignon or Merlot does the trick. It adds depth.
- 2 tablespoons (30ml) tomato paste.
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me.
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ary.
- 1 bay leaf. Don't forget to take it out before serving, eh?
- Salt and black pepper, to taste.
- 2 tablespoons (30ml) c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ons (30ml) cold water (slurry optional). For thickening, innit?
Seasoning Notes
The secret to a great hearty beef stew is in the seasoning. Thyme and rosemary are essential . They give that warm, homey vibe.
A bay leaf is a must. For an extra kick, a pinch of smoked paprika can really make it sing.
Don't be shy with the salt and pepper. Season as you go, tasting along the way to get the taste just so.
If you don’t have fresh thyme or rosemary, dried ones will do perfectly. Just remember to use about half the amount, as dried herbs are more potent than fresh.
You can also add a dash of Worcestershire sauce for a deeper, richer flavour.

step-by-step Process
- Toss 2 lbs of beef cubes in 2 tablespoons of seasoned flour. Make sure all the beef is nicely coated, mind.
- Sear the beef in 2 tablespoons of hot oil in a pan. Brown it on all sides. Don't overcrowd the pan. Work in batches.
- Sauté the chopped onion, carrots, and celery for 5- 7 minutes. Get them nice and soft. Then, add the minced garlic and cook for another minute. Smells amazing, doesn’t it?
- Chuck all the veggies into the crockpot , followed by the browned beef. Add 4 cups of beef broth, 1 cup of red wine (optional), 2 tablespoons of tomato paste, 1 teaspoon of dried thyme, 1 teaspoon of dried rosemary, and 1 bay leaf. Season well.
- C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ours . You want the beef super tender.
- Stir in 1 cup of frozen peas and 1 cup of frozen green beans (optional) in the last 30 minutes .
- To thicken the stew, mix 2 tablespoons of cornstarch with 2 tablespoons of cold water. Stir it in during the last 15 minutes .
- Serve it up piping hot and enjoy this beef stew with vegetables !

Storage Sorted: Keeping Your Stew Fresh
Right, so you've got leftovers. Lucky you! This beef stew with vegetables tastes even better the next day, honestly.
Pop it in an airtight container and it'll keep in the fridge for up to 3 days . For longer storage, you can freeze it.
Just let it cool completely first. It'll last for about 3 months in the freezer. When you're ready to eat it, defrost it overnight in the fridge, then reheat gently on the hob or in the microwave.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this beef stew crockpot recipe ahead of time?
Absolutely! In fact, a beef stew crockpot recipe often tastes even better the next day as the flavors have had more time to meld. Just let it cool completely before refrigerating in an airtight container.
You can then reheat it g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, adding a splash of beef broth if needed to loosen it up.
My beef stew is a bit watery; how do I thicken it up?
No worries, that's an easy fix! The recipe includes a cornstarch slurry option for thickening - just mix cornstarch with cold water until smooth and stir it into the stew during the last 15 minutes of cooking.
Alternatively, you can mash some of the potatoes in the stew to naturally thicken the gravy, a bit like a culinary magic trick!
What's the best cut of beef to use for this slow cooker beef stew recipe?
Beef chuck is generally considered the gold standard for slow cooker beef stew. It has a good amount of marbling (that's the fat within the muscle) that breaks down during the long cooking time, resulting in incredibly tender and flavorful meat.
Stewing beef, which is usually chuck already cut into cubes, is also a perfectly acceptable shortcut.
Can I freeze leftover beef stew crockpot recipe?
You bet! Allow the stew to cool completely before transferring it to freezer safe containers or zip-top bags. Lay the bags flat in the freezer to save space and for quicker thawing. When you're ready to enjoy it, thaw it overnight in the refrigerator and reheat thoroughly on the stovetop or in the microwave.

Is there a way to make this beef stew crockpot recipe healthier?
Certainly! You can trim excess fat from the beef before cooking and use low-sodium beef broth to reduce the salt content. Loading up on vegetables like carrots, celery, and peas will add extra nutrients and fiber. And remember portion control; even a delicious, hearty stew should be enjoyed in moderation.
I don't have any red wine. Can I still make this slow cooker beef stew?
Absolutely! While red wine adds a lovely depth of flavor, it's not essential. Simply substitute the red wine with an equal amount of beef broth. For a little extra flavour, consider adding a splash of balsamic vinegar or Worcestershire sauce to mimic some of the wine's richness - just a subtle hint!
